EASTERN Cape High Court Judge Nambitha Dambuza and Johannesburg High Court Judge Rammaka Mathopo were recommended for appointment to the Supreme Court of Appeal, the Judicial Service Commission (JSC) said on Tuesday night.The two were always considered as front-runners, with Judge Dambuza the only woman candidate.She sailed through her interview, handling the only possible sticky point — a comment about her "paucity of reported judgments" — graciously.She said that no one had said about her judgments, reported or unreported, that she had not applied her mind or interrogated matters sufficiently.
